PNC reported $6.875 billion of revenue and $2.055 billion of net income, up from $6.165 billion and $1.772 billion in the first quarter and $5.661 billion and $1.643 billion in the second quarter of 2025. Net interest income increased to $4.107 billion, while noninterest income reached $2.768 billion, lifting noninterest income to 40% of revenue from 36% in the prior quarter. Net interest margin improved modestly to 2.96% from 2.95% in the first quarter and 2.80% a year earlier. Provision for credit losses declined to $191 million from $210 million sequentially and $254 million a year earlier. Noninterest expense rose to $4.098 billion from $3.768 billion sequentially and $3.383 billion a year earlier, leaving efficiency at 60%, unchanged from a year earlier.

The only period-ahead context is that second-quarter results include the full-quarter benefit of FirstBank, following its January 5 acquisition and the June conversion of customers, employees, and branches.
